The Rusty Jackson Band and the Midnight Juliets will perform the history of country music across 30 songs, starting with the Carter Family and spanning five decades, at 6 p.m. Saturday, Feb. 11, at Lake City Center.

Country and hillbilly music was the soundtrack for Rusty Jackson's young life and the stories behind it all were the subtext. The music history show brings the stories and the songs together for a night of infotainment, written and produced by Jackson.

Chrissy Summering joins Jackson with special guest Tom Richards, and band members Ben Vogel, Brad Jeanes, Duane Becker, Harry Batty and Suzaan Botha. The entire crew brings authenticity and energy to classic country hits.

Attend to hear about the country beginnings in Bristol, Tenn., the Opry, Western Swing, Honky Tonk, the Nashville sound, Bakersfield, Outlaws, In-laws and more.

People are encouraged to show up in their best hillbilly hat and pair of overalls.
